Delegation of Korea Aviation Meteorological Agency (KAMA) visiting the Observatory

21 October 2011

A group of 3 delegates of KAMA , led by its Director of Information and Technology Support Division Mr. JO Gi-Hyun, visited the Hong Kong Observatory on 18 and 19 October 2011 . They shared with Observatory staff experiences in the provision of aviation weather service, such as aviation weather information for flight crew and operators, windshear detection and alerting, and the processing of meteorological observational data. They also visited the Airport Meteorological Office and a LIght Detection And Ranging (LIDAR) site at the Hong Kong International Airport. The visit strengthened the tie between KAMA and the Observatory. In particular, exploration would be made on further cooperation and technical exchange between the two parties in the future.
